History
Borrowed from Dutch hoi, compare ahoy.
Reduced Anglicized form of Irish Ó hEochaidh (“descendant of Eochaid”).
From Orkney and Shetland Scots Hoy, from Old Norse há (“high”) + ey (“island”).
Borrowed from German Heu or Dutch gooi.
Perhaps related to hoick and hoist.
